导读:
MySQL集群是一种高可用性、高性能的数据库解决方案 , 可以极大地提升系统的稳定性和性能 。在选择MySQL集群时 , 需要考虑多个因素,包括硬件设备、网络结构、负载均衡等 。本文将为您介绍MySQL集群的组成部分以及如何选择合适的方案 。
1. 数据库服务器
MySQL集群中最重要的组成部分就是数据库服务器 。在选择数据库服务器时,需要考虑其处理器、内存、硬盘等硬件配置,以及操作系统和MySQL版本等软件环境 。同时,还需要根据实际需求选择单机还是分布式部署 。
【mysql集群架构 mysql集群用什么】2. 负载均衡器
负载均衡器是MySQL集群中的另一个关键组成部分,它可以将请求均匀地分配到不同的数据库服务器上,从而提高系统的性能和可用性 。常见的负载均衡器有LVS、HAProxy等 。
3. 存储设备
存储设备也是MySQL集群中不可或缺的组成部分 。在选择存储设备时,需要考虑其容量、速度、可靠性等因素 。常见的存储设备有SAN、NAS等 。
4. 网络结构
MySQL集群的网络结构也需要仔细设计,包括网络拓扑、IP地址规划、防火墙等 。合理的网络结构可以提高系统的可用性和安全性 。
总结:
选择适合自己的MySQL集群方案需要考虑多个因素 , 包括硬件设备、网络结构、负载均衡等 。只有在综合考虑了这些因素之后,才能搭建出高可用性、高性能的MySQL集群 。
推荐阅读
- mysql取最新一条 mysql选出最大一条
- mysql 分页 rownum mysql分页语句字段
- mysql获取数据库名称 获取mysql的网址
- mysql向表中添加列的命令 mysql命令行添加列
- mysql 导入数据文件 mysql导入数据时出错
- mysqlc库
- 时间取年月的sql 时间取年mysql
- 如何在云服务器上搭建代码仓库? 云服务器怎么搭建代码仓库
- 如何应对恶意攻击服务器? 恶意攻击服务器怎么办